当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机可以装在d盘吗,虚拟机能安装在d盘吗

虚拟机可以装在d盘吗,虚拟机能安装在d盘吗

***:该内容仅为两个相似的问句,即“虚拟机可以装在d盘吗”与“虚拟机能安装在d盘吗”,没有更多相关阐述。这两个问句主要围绕虚拟机是否能够安装在电脑D盘这一问题展开,没...

***:该内容主要围绕虚拟机是否可以安装在D盘提出疑问,仅给出这一简单的关于虚拟机安装位置的问题,没有更多的相关阐述,如系统环境、虚拟机类型等可能影响其能否安装在D盘的因素,也未提及是否存在某些限制或特殊要求,是非常简洁且单一的关于虚拟机安装位置的提问。

本文目录导读:

  1. 虚拟机安装在D盘的可行性
  2. 将虚拟机安装在D盘的操作步骤
  3. 虚拟机安装在D盘的注意事项
  4. 虚拟机安装在D盘的技术原理相关

《虚拟机安装在D盘:可行性、操作步骤、注意事项及相关技术解析》

在当今的计算机技术领域,虚拟机(Virtual Machine)的应用越来越广泛,无论是用于软件开发、测试不同操作系统环境,还是进行系统安全研究等方面,虚拟机都发挥着重要的作用,当我们准备安装虚拟机时,磁盘分区的选择是一个需要考虑的问题,其中一个常见的疑问就是虚拟机能否安装在D盘,本文将围绕这个问题展开深入探讨,涵盖虚拟机安装在D盘的可行性、具体操作步骤、需要注意的事项以及相关的技术原理等多个方面。

虚拟机安装在D盘的可行性

(一)从操作系统和文件系统的角度

1、操作系统的磁盘管理机制

虚拟机可以装在d盘吗,虚拟机能安装在d盘吗

- 现代操作系统(如Windows、Linux等)在磁盘管理方面具有很强的灵活性,对于Windows操作系统来说,它支持将程序安装在除系统盘(通常为C盘)之外的其他逻辑分区,如D盘,虚拟机软件本质上也是一个程序,只要满足一定的磁盘空间、文件系统格式等要求,就可以安装在D盘。

- 在文件系统方面,常见的NTFS(Windows环境下)和ext4(Linux环境下)等文件系统都支持在非系统盘分区存储大型程序及其相关文件,D盘如果采用了合适的文件系统格式,就能够为虚拟机提供足够的空间来存储虚拟机镜像文件(如VMware的.vmx、.vmdk文件等)以及其他相关配置文件。

2、磁盘空间分配与使用

- D盘通常是用户自定义的分区,可以根据用户需求分配大小,如果D盘有足够的可用空间,那么安装虚拟机是完全可行的,一个中等规模的虚拟机(安装Windows 10操作系统,分配2GB内存和20GB磁盘空间给虚拟机)可能需要在D盘预留至少20 - 30GB的空间,以容纳虚拟机的操作系统文件、应用程序安装文件以及可能产生的临时文件等。

(二)虚拟机软件的兼容性

1、主流虚拟机软件的支持

- 以VMware Workstation为例,它在安装过程中提供了选择安装路径的选项,可以轻松指定D盘作为安装目录,VMware的软件架构设计使得它能够适应不同的磁盘分区布局,只要目标分区满足软件运行的基本条件,如足够的读写权限、足够的剩余空间等。

- 同样,Oracle VirtualBox也支持将其安装在D盘,在安装过程中,用户可以通过浏览按钮选择D盘的文件夹作为安装位置,这种兼容性是基于虚拟机软件的开发理念,旨在为用户提供更多的安装选择,以满足不同用户的磁盘管理策略和硬件资源分布情况。

将虚拟机安装在D盘的操作步骤

(一)VMware Workstation安装在D盘

1、下载VMware Workstation安装程序

- 从VMware官方网站下载VMware Workstation的安装程序(例如VMware Workstation Pro版本),确保下载的版本与你的操作系统(Windows或Linux)相匹配。

2、运行安装程序

- 双击下载的安装程序,启动安装向导,在安装向导的初始界面,会提示你接受软件许可协议等常规操作。

3、选择安装路径

- 在安装过程中,会有一个步骤让你选择安装位置,点击“浏览”按钮,导航到D盘的一个合适文件夹,可以在D盘创建一个名为“VMware”的文件夹,然后将安装路径指定为“D:\VMware”。

4、完成安装

- 选择好安装路径后,按照安装向导的提示继续完成其他设置,如是否创建桌面快捷方式、是否自动检查更新等,点击“安装”按钮,等待安装过程完成。

(二)Oracle VirtualBox安装在D盘

1、获取Oracle VirtualBox安装包

虚拟机可以装在d盘吗,虚拟机能安装在d盘吗

- 从Oracle官方网站下载Oracle VirtualBox的安装包,根据你的操作系统版本(如Windows x64或Linux的特定发行版)选择正确的安装包。

2、启动安装流程

- 运行下载的安装包,在初始安装界面,会显示一些关于软件的基本信息和安装说明。

3、指定安装目录

- 在安装过程中,会有一个界面让你选择安装的目标文件夹,点击旁边的“浏览”按钮,选择D盘的某个文件夹作为安装目录,你可以选择“D:\VirtualBox”作为安装路径。

4、安装后续操作

- 确定安装路径后,继续按照安装向导的提示进行操作,如选择是否创建开始菜单快捷方式、是否安装附加功能等,完成这些设置后,点击“安装”按钮,等待安装完成。

虚拟机安装在D盘的注意事项

(一)磁盘空间管理

1、预留足够空间

- 在安装虚拟机之前,要准确评估虚拟机的需求,如果计划在虚拟机中安装大型操作系统(如Windows Server系列)或者运行资源密集型应用程序,需要预留更多的磁盘空间在D盘,安装Windows Server 2019可能需要至少40 - 50GB的磁盘空间,而且随着使用过程中系统更新、应用程序安装和数据存储,这个空间需求还会增加。

2、磁盘空间监控

- 安装在D盘的虚拟机在使用过程中,要定期监控D盘的剩余空间,因为虚拟机的虚拟磁盘文件(如.vmdk文件)会随着虚拟机内部数据的增加而增大,如果D盘空间不足,可能会导致虚拟机运行出现问题,如无法创建新的快照、虚拟机性能下降(由于磁盘I/O受阻)等,可以使用Windows自带的磁盘管理工具或者第三方磁盘管理软件(如DiskGenius)来监控D盘的空间使用情况。

(二)磁盘性能影响

1、D盘的物理位置与性能

- 如果计算机使用的是机械硬盘,D盘的物理位置(例如是位于硬盘的内圈还是外圈)可能会影响虚拟机的磁盘I/O性能,位于硬盘外圈的扇区读写速度相对较快,如果D盘的分区位于硬盘性能较差的区域,可能会导致虚拟机启动速度慢、运行应用程序时磁盘读写延迟高等问题,对于固态硬盘(SSD)虽然整体性能较好,但不同的主控芯片和闪存颗粒质量也会对D盘的性能产生一定影响,进而影响虚拟机的运行。

2、磁盘碎片整理(针对机械硬盘)

- 如果计算机使用机械硬盘,并且D盘经过长时间使用产生了大量磁盘碎片,这会影响虚拟机的性能,因为虚拟机的文件读取和写入操作可能会因为磁盘碎片而变得分散,增加了磁头寻道时间,定期对D盘进行磁盘碎片整理(可以使用Windows自带的磁盘碎片整理工具)可以提高虚拟机在D盘上的运行效率。

(三)数据安全与备份

1、虚拟机数据的重要性

虚拟机可以装在d盘吗,虚拟机能安装在d盘吗

- 虚拟机内部可能存储着重要的操作系统、应用程序数据、用户文件等,安装在D盘并不意味着数据就绝对安全,要确保对虚拟机的数据进行定期备份,可以使用虚拟机软件自带的备份功能(如VMware Workstation的快照和克隆功能)或者将虚拟机的虚拟磁盘文件(.vmdk等)手动备份到其他存储介质(如外部硬盘)。

2、D盘故障风险

- D盘所在的硬盘可能会出现故障,如硬盘出现坏道、电机故障等,如果发生这种情况,安装在D盘的虚拟机数据可能会丢失,在条件允许的情况下,可以考虑使用磁盘阵列(RAID)技术来提高D盘的可靠性,或者将重要的虚拟机数据备份到云端存储服务(如百度网盘、腾讯微云等)。

虚拟机安装在D盘的技术原理相关

(一)虚拟机磁盘文件存储机制

1、虚拟磁盘文件格式

- 以VMware的虚拟机为例,其常用的虚拟磁盘文件格式为.vmdk,这个文件在D盘存储时,实际上是对虚拟机内部磁盘的一种模拟,在虚拟机运行时,虚拟机软件通过特定的驱动程序和文件系统访问协议,将对虚拟机内部磁盘的读写操作转换为对.vmdk文件的操作,当虚拟机中的操作系统要写入一个文件到其C盘(虚拟机内部的C盘)时,虚拟机软件会将这个写入操作映射到.vmdk文件中的相应数据块。

- 对于VirtualBox来说,其虚拟磁盘文件格式如.vdi也有类似的存储和操作机制,这些虚拟磁盘文件不仅存储了虚拟机操作系统和应用程序的实际数据,还包含了磁盘的分区表、文件系统结构等信息,使得虚拟机能够像在真实物理磁盘上一样运行操作系统和应用程序。

2、动态分配与固定大小磁盘文件

- 虚拟机的虚拟磁盘文件可以设置为动态分配或固定大小,如果选择动态分配(如在VMware Workstation中),.vmdk文件在初始创建时可能只占用很小的空间,随着虚拟机内部数据的写入而逐渐增大,直到达到预先设定的最大容量,这种方式在D盘空间利用上比较灵活,适合初始不确定虚拟机磁盘空间需求的情况,而固定大小的虚拟磁盘文件则在创建时就占用指定的全部磁盘空间,虽然在磁盘性能上可能有一定优势(减少了动态扩展时的磁盘I/O开销),但需要在D盘一次性预留足够的空间。

(二)虚拟机与主机磁盘I/O交互

1、I/O请求处理

- 当虚拟机中的操作系统发起磁盘I/O请求(如读取一个应用程序文件)时,虚拟机软件会拦截这个请求,对于安装在D盘的虚拟机,虚拟机软件会将这个请求转换为对D盘上相应虚拟磁盘文件的I/O操作,这个转换过程涉及到多个层次的处理,包括虚拟机软件内部的磁盘管理层、主机操作系统的文件系统层以及磁盘驱动程序层。

- 在主机操作系统为Windows的情况下,虚拟机软件(如VMware Workstation)会与Windows的磁盘驱动程序交互,将虚拟机的磁盘I/O请求转化为对D盘的实际读写操作,如果D盘的磁盘I/O性能不佳(如存在磁盘瓶颈或者高磁盘使用率),就会影响虚拟机的运行速度和响应能力。

2、磁盘缓存策略

- 虚拟机软件通常会采用一定的磁盘缓存策略来提高磁盘I/O效率,VMware Workstation可以设置不同的磁盘缓存模式,如“Write - Through”(直写模式)和“Write - Back”(回写模式),在将虚拟机安装在D盘时,不同的磁盘缓存模式会对D盘的写入操作产生不同的影响。“Write - Back”模式可以提高写入性能,但在主机突然断电等情况下可能会存在数据丢失风险;“Write - Through”模式则相对更安全,但写入速度可能会稍慢,合理选择磁盘缓存模式可以根据D盘的特性(如是否为SSD、磁盘的可靠性等)和虚拟机的使用需求(如对数据安全性和性能的权衡)来进行优化。

虚拟机是可以安装在D盘的,并且在满足一定条件下能够正常运行,从可行性方面来看,操作系统的磁盘管理机制和虚拟机软件的兼容性都为这种安装方式提供了支持,在实际操作过程中,我们需要按照虚拟机软件的安装步骤正确指定D盘为安装路径,要注意磁盘空间管理、磁盘性能影响以及数据安全与备份等多方面的问题,深入理解虚拟机安装在D盘的技术原理,如虚拟磁盘文件存储机制和虚拟机与主机磁盘I/O交互等,有助于我们更好地优化虚拟机的运行环境,提高虚拟机的使用效率和可靠性,无论是对于个人用户进行简单的操作系统体验,还是企业用户进行大规模的软件开发和测试,将虚拟机安装在D盘都是一种可行的选择,但需要综合考虑各种因素来确保虚拟机的稳定运行。

黑狐家游戏

发表评论

最新文章